Description

KLHDC9 (Kelch domain containing 9) is a protein-coding gene located on chromosome 1q32.1. It encodes a protein belonging to the BTB-kelch family, characterized by a BTB/POZ domain and multiple kelch repeats. The protein is predicted to function as a substrate adaptor for Cullin-RING E3 ubiquitin ligases, potentially involved in ubiquitination and protein degradation. KLHDC9 is expressed in various tissues, with notable levels in the brain and testis. Its exact physiological roles and disease associations are still under investigation, but emerging evidence suggests involvement in cellular processes such as cell cycle regulation and stress response.

Protein Summary

The KLHDC9 protein is a 399-amino acid polypeptide with a predicted molecular weight of ~45 kDa. It contains an N-terminal BTB/POZ domain and six C-terminal kelch repeats, which are typical of BTB-kelch proteins. The BTB domain mediates protein-protein interactions and dimerization, while kelch repeats form a beta-propeller structure that can bind to substrates. KLHDC9 is predicted to act as a substrate adaptor for Cullin-RING E3 ligases, targeting specific proteins for ubiquitination and proteasomal degradation. Its expression in brain and testis suggests roles in neuronal and reproductive functions, but experimental validation is needed.
